TL 0902 ABBOTS LANGLEY HIGH STREET (Southeast side) Abbots Langley
11/42 No. 23
GV II
House. Early C19 front set back from road, earlier origins to rear.
Possibly timber framed. Red brick front. Machine tiled roof. 2 storeys.
1 window front. Plinth. Entrance to left. 20 pane sashes with a small casement over entrance. Large stack with multiple flues rises out of right end of ridge adjoining No. 25 (q.v.). Roof hipped to rear with a low gabled wing. Interior not inspected. Included for group value.
